Does Baker Hughes offer a subsea compression system?
Baker Hughes is able to provide a fully-integrated subsea compression system, complete with subsea power distribution. Using our Blue-C™ centrifugal compressors, our subsea compression systems are placed as close to the wellhead as possible to maximize compression efficiency.

Can a subsea compression system be installed on the seafloor?
Now, we can place compression systems on the seafloor, eliminating the need for costly topside facilities and reducing your overall health, safety and environment concerns. Baker Hughes is able to provide a fully-integrated subsea compression system, complete with subsea power distribution.
What is a subsea gas-compression system?
Our subsea gas-compression systems are designed and developed with industry partners to significantly improve the economics of mature gas fields. We have extensive experience in designing subsea compression systems for both dry-gas and wet-gas applications, with power from topside or subsea power-distribution systems.
How deep is the world's deepest subsea compression system?
Approximately 55% of its gas reserves have been produced since 2007, and a solution was needed to extend its lifetime and further maximize its recovery. We co-designed with A/S Norske Shell the world’s deepest subsea compression system, which will be powered by hydroelectric energy and operate at a water depth of 900 m.
